What can be done to stop the epidemic of underage drinking and other drug abuse?
The AMA advocates numerous ways to combat this growing epidemic, including:
- Increasing enforcement of underage drinking laws
- Reducing access to alcohol for children and youth (the family home is a primary place teens acquire alcohol)
- Reducing sales and provision of alcohol to children and youth
- Providing more education about the harmful effects of alcohol and other drug abuse
- Talk to children early and often about drug use, setting clear standards and expectations opposing use
- Reducing the demand for alcohol and the normalization of alcohol use by children and youth
